[0003] At present, with the improvement of the quality of life of the people, the functional requirements of users for air conditioners are not limited to refrigeration and heating, and the freshness degree of indoor air is also required. Therefore, the air conditioner generally introduces a fresh air module to realize the function of replacing fresh air, improve the comfort of users, and improve the indoor environment of users.

[0004] However, in the prior art, the fresh air module is not easy to maintain due to the installation environment of the air conditioner. Content of the utility model

[0005] To solve the above technical problems, the utility model provides an air conditioner, which aims to at least solve the technical problem that the fresh air module is not easy to maintain due to the installation environment of the air conditioner.

[0049] The air conditioner provided in the embodiment aims to at least solve the technical problem that the new air module is not easy to maintain due to the limitation of the installation environment of the air conditioner.

[0050] Figure 1 It is an installation schematic diagram of the air conditioner of some embodiments; Figure 2 It is Figure 1 It is a rear view of the air conditioner; Figure 3 It is Figure 1 It is a connection schematic diagram of the main body of the air conditioner and the new air module. Combined with Figure 1 ,Figure 2 and Figure 3 The air conditioner of the embodiment of the application comprises a main body 10, a fresh air module 20 and an electric control assembly 30. The main body 10 is provided with a first opening 101. The fresh air module 20 is detachably connected with the main body 10 or is spaced apart from the main body 10 and is provided with a second opening 201. The electric control assembly 30 is arranged on the main body 10 and is electrically connected with the fresh air module 20.

[0051] The air conditioner can be a ducted type air conditioner or a wall-mounted air conditioner.

[0052] Since the fresh air module 20 is detachably connected with the main body 10 or is spaced apart from the main body 10, when the main body 10 and the fresh air module 20 are installed in an environmental element, if the fresh air module 20 is located above a position where the environmental element cannot be provided with a maintenance opening, the fresh air module 20 can be spaced apart from the main body 10, so that the fresh air module 20 avoids the position where the environmental element cannot be provided with a maintenance opening, and the fresh air module 20 can be located above a position where the environmental element can be provided with a maintenance opening. The maintenance opening is provided on the environmental element, and when the fresh air module 20 needs to be maintained, the fresh air module 20 can be directly maintained through the maintenance opening, thereby improving the maintenance efficiency. If the environmental element as a whole cannot be provided with a maintenance opening, the fresh air module 20 can be connected with the main body 10, and when the fresh air module 20 needs to be maintained, the fresh air module 20 can be directly detached from the shell and taken out of the environmental element for maintenance of the fresh air module 20, thereby facilitating the maintenance of the fresh air module 20 and expanding the application scenarios of the fresh air module 20. Since the electric control assembly 30 is arranged on the main body 10 and is electrically connected with the fresh air module 20, the actions of the main body 10 and the fresh air module 20 can be controlled through the electric control assembly 30, so as to realize the linkage between the fresh air module 20 and the main body 10. The control can be directly performed through a control terminal, thereby simplifying the control mode, saving costs and facilitating user operation.

[0053] Since the main body 10 is provided with the first opening 101 and the fresh air module 20 is provided with the second opening 201, the fresh air module 20 can independently blow air through the second opening 201, and the main body 10 can independently blow air through the first opening 101. The first opening 101 and the second opening 201 are both independent air outlets, and the fresh air module 20 and the main body 10 can be independently operated, so that the air outlet of the fresh air module 20 is no longer limited by the air outlet of the main body 10, thereby realizing that the fresh air module 20 can adapt to various types and specifications of the main body 10 and achieving compatibility.

[0054] In some embodiments, the control terminal can be a remote controller, a mobile phone, a tablet computer, a computer or the like.

[0055] When the air conditioner is a ducted type, a fresh air module is generally spliced on the platform of the ducted type. Since the length of the ducted type body is 700 mm and the maintenance space of the electric control box is 300 mm, when the ducted type is installed in a bedroom, the environmental element is generally a wardrobe 40, and the width of the general bedroom corridor is about 1000 mm. When the fresh air module 20 is spliced on the side, the fresh air module 20 is easy to face the vertical wall 401 of the wardrobe 40, and the vertical wall 401 cannot be opened. In combination with Figure 1 and Figure 2 In some embodiments, the fresh air module 20 is spaced apart from the main body 10 to avoid the vertical wall 401, and then a maintenance opening 402 is opened on the support plate arranged in the horizontal direction of the wardrobe 40. The fresh air module 20 can be maintained through the maintenance opening 402, which improves the maintenance efficiency. If the user does not agree to open the maintenance opening on the wardrobe 40 or the structure of the wardrobe 40 itself causes the whole wardrobe 40 to be unable to open the maintenance opening, the fresh air module 20 can be installed on the main body 10. When the fresh air module 20 needs to be maintained, the fresh air module 20 can be directly detached from the shell and taken out of the environmental element for maintenance of the fresh air module 20, so as to facilitate the maintenance of the fresh air module 20 and expand the application scenario of the fresh air module 20.

[0056] In combination with Figure 2 In some embodiments, the wardrobe 40 is provided with an air outlet 403, so that the fresh air of the fresh air module 20 and the cold and hot air of the main body 10 enter the room. In order to achieve uniform air outlet and ensure aesthetics, an air outlet grille 404 is arranged at the air outlet 403.

[0057] In combination with Figure 1 and Figure 2 In some embodiments, when the fresh air module 20 is detachably connected with the main body 10 and needs to be maintained, the air outlet grille 404 is detached from the wardrobe 40, and then the fresh air module 20 is detached from the main body 10. Since the height of the fresh air module 20 is generally greater than the width of the air outlet 403, and the width of the fresh air module 20 is generally less than the width of the air outlet 403, the fresh air module 20 can be rotated by 90°, so as to be taken out of the wardrobe 40. The maintenance personnel can maintain the fresh air module 20 at a larger space, so as to facilitate the maintenance of the fresh air module 20.

[0058] When the environmental element is a wardrobe 40, the fresh air module 20 is not convenient to be directly connected with the wardrobe 40. Figure 7 For Figure 1 The connection diagram of the hanging plate of the air conditioner and the fresh air module. In combination with Figure 7In some embodiments, in order to facilitate the installation of the fresh air module 20, the air conditioner further comprises a hanging plate 50. The hanging plate 50 is arranged in a spaced manner with the main body 10. Wherein, when the fresh air module 20 is arranged in a spaced manner with the main body 10, the fresh air module 20 is detachably connected with the hanging plate 50.

[0059] In some embodiments, the hanging plate 50 is connected with the wardrobe 40, and the fresh air module 20 is installed on the hanging plate 50, which facilitates the installation of the fresh air module 20 and can improve the installation efficiency. At the same time, the hanging plate 50 avoids the vertical wall 401, and a maintenance opening 402 can be formed below the hanging plate 50 and the fresh air module 20. When the filter element of the fresh air module 20 needs to be replaced, the maintenance opening 402 can be used for maintenance. When the fresh air module 20 needs to be overhauled, if the area of the maintenance opening 402 is greater than the area of the fresh air module 20, the fresh air module 20 can be detached from the hanging plate 50, and the fresh air module 20 can be directly taken out through the maintenance opening 402. If the area of the maintenance opening 402 is less than the area of the fresh air module 20, the air outlet grille 404 is detached from the wardrobe 40, the fresh air module 20 is detached from the hanging plate 50, the fresh air module 20 is rotated by 90°, and the fresh air module 20 is taken out from the wardrobe 40 through the air outlet 403, so that the maintenance personnel can perform maintenance on the fresh air module 20 in a larger space, thereby facilitating the maintenance of the fresh air module 20.

[0062] In some embodiments, one of the first buckle 60 and the second buckle 70 is provided with a clamping groove, and the other can be clamped in the clamping groove to realize the connection between the fresh air module 20 and the main body 10 or the hanging plate 50.

[0063] In some embodiments, since the fresh air module 20 will send fresh air, in order to avoid the clamping groove penetrating the fresh air module 20 and causing air leakage, the second buckle 70 is provided with a clamping groove to ensure the air volume of the fresh air.

[0064] Figure 12 For Figure 11 The enlarged view of A in the middle. In combination with Figure 11 and Figure 12 In some embodiments, in order to avoid the fresh air module 20 affecting the action of the main body 10 when running, the end surface of the fresh air module 20 facing the main body 10 is provided with a damping member 80, and damping is performed through the damping member 80 to ensure the stability of the working of the fresh air module 20 and the main body 10. The damping member 80 can be a soft material, such as foam, plastic, rubber or sponge.

[0065] In combination with Figure 11 and Figure 12 In some embodiments, in order to ensure the stability of the buckling of the first buckle 60 and the second buckle 70, the damping member 80 is provided with a mounting groove 801, and the first buckle 60 comprises a mounting portion 601 and a buckle portion 602. The mounting portion 601 is arranged in the mounting groove 801 and connected with the fresh air module 20, and the mounting portion 601 is exposed outside the mounting groove 801. The buckle portion 602 is connected with the mounting portion 601 and can be buckled with the second buckle 70. The mounting portion 601 can protrude 1mm-3mm from the surface of the damping member 80.

[0066] In combination with Figure 11 and Figure 12 In some embodiments, the mounting portion 601 is arranged in the mounting groove 801 and connected with the fresh air module 20, and the mounting portion 601 is supported by the fresh air module 20. The buckle portion 602 is connected with the mounting portion 601, so that the mounting portion 601 can support the buckle portion 602. The buckle portion 602 is buckled with the second buckle 70 to realize the connection between the fresh air module 20 and the main body 10 or the hanging plate 50.

[0067] Since the end face of the fresh air module 20 towards the main body 10 is provided with a damping piece 80, the damping piece 80 is made of soft material, which causes the size of the damping piece 80 to be unstable, so that the first clamping piece 60 is difficult to be clamped with the second clamping piece 70, and the clamping condition is also prone to looseness. In some embodiments, the mounting portion 601 is exposed to the mounting groove 801, the mounting portion 601 is made of hard material, and the hanging plate 50 or the main body 10 is also made of hard material. When the clamping portion 602 is clamped with the second clamping piece 70, the mounting portion 601 can abut against the hanging plate 50 or the main body 10, and can provide support force to each other to avoid deformation, facilitate clamping of the clamping portion 602 and the second clamping piece 70, and ensure stability of clamping of the clamping portion 602 and the second clamping piece 70. At the same time, precise assembly of the clamping portion 602 and the second clamping piece 70 is also achieved.

[0068] In some embodiments, in order to ensure stability of connection between the mounting portion 601 and the clamping portion 602, the mounting portion 601 can be integrally formed with the clamping portion 602, which ensures structural strength of the first clamping piece 60, and also reduces processing cost and facilitates preparation.
